About This Book
Kids all around the world have dreams, pets, and favorite foods just like you! From snowy Finland to sunny New Zealand, these 23 children share their stories and invite you to explore their homes. Discover how different places can feel surprisingly familiar—and why that connection matters.

Quick Assessment
This engaging sticker book introduces young readers to 23 children from diverse countries, highlighting their daily lives, hobbies, and aspirations. Designed for early readers aged 5-8, it combines human geography with social awareness, encouraging curiosity about global cultures in an interactive format. The content is gentle and suitable for young children learning about diversity and inclusivity.
